Oioba is a Porto, Portugal–based swimwear brand, founded in 2016. The label emphasizes ethical, sustainable fashion, producing bikinis and one-pieces from eco-friendly fabrics. Oioba collections feature minimalist designs, muted tones, and versatile cuts, reflecting a modern European sensibility. The brand prioritizes slow fashion, small-scale production, and transparent practices to ensure responsible consumption. Oioba appeals to women who want timeless, understated swimwear crafted with care and respect for the environment. What makes the brand unique is its strong commitment to sustainability paired with minimalist design—creating pieces that last across seasons rather than chasing fleeting trends.

Yasmine Eslami is a Paris-based luxury lingerie and swimwear brand, founded in 2010 by designer Yasmine Eslami. Drawing on her background in fashion and lingerie design, she created the label to merge femininity, minimalism, and sophistication. The swimwear line offers bikinis and one-pieces crafted with clean cuts, solid colors, and timeless silhouettes. The brand emphasizes fit and comfort, ensuring designs flatter natural body shapes while maintaining understated elegance. Yasmine Eslami appeals to women who appreciate Parisian refinement and subtle luxury. What makes the brand unique is its ability to blend lingerie sensibilities—delicate, flattering design—with modern swimwear.

Underprotection is a Copenhagen, Denmark–based sustainable fashion brand, founded in 2010 by Sunniva Uggerby and Stephan Rosenkilde. The label produces lingerie, loungewear, and swimwear crafted from eco-friendly materials such as recycled polyester and organic cotton. Its swimwear collections emphasize Scandinavian minimalism, featuring clean lines, soft palettes, and timeless cuts. Underprotection is widely recognized for combining style, ethics, and responsibility. What makes the brand unique is its holistic sustainability model—from fabrics to packaging—paired with chic, fashion-forward design.

Leslie Amon is a Paris-based luxury swimwear brand, founded in 2017 by designer Leslie Amon. The label produces fashion-forward swimwear and resortwear that merge high-end couture influences with bold, playful styling. Its collections often feature metallic fabrics, dramatic cuts, and unique embellishments, blurring the lines between swimwear and ready-to-wear. Leslie Amon emphasizes luxury craftsmanship, creating pieces that stand out as statement fashion both on the beach and beyond. What makes the brand distinctive is its couture-inspired swimwear identity, offering designs that are glamorous, daring, and fashion-driven. With its Parisian roots and high-fashion edge, Leslie Amon appeals to women who want swimwear that feels bold, luxurious, and trend-setting.

Julienne Swim is a Lausanne, Switzerland-based swimwear brand, founded in 2019 by Julie Dizerens and Émie Schmid. The label produces high-quality bikinis and one-pieces with a focus on timeless design, sustainability, and functionality. Its collections often feature clean silhouettes, muted tones, and versatile fits made from eco-friendly fabrics. Julienne Swim emphasizes slow fashion and transparency, producing in Europe with ethical practices. What makes the brand unique is its Swiss precision and simplicity, creating swimwear that feels refined, durable, and responsibly made. By combining minimal design with sustainability, Julienne Swim appeals to women who want fashion that balances elegance with eco-conscious values.
